Employees of Innopolis University, Russia, took an opinion poll among 300 young robotics enthusiasts and discovered what they think about future, artificial intelligence and human-robot interaction.

Every day the number of robots keeps growing thus making them an integral part of our life. So far, there is at least 20 types of robots worldwide: starting from industrial robots and mega-factories up to molecular-size nanorobots.

Henn na Hotel in Nagasaki, Japan, opened just a year ago with 90% of its employees being robots. Smart machines welcome guests at reception, deliver luggage in rooms, make coffee, provide cleaning and laundry services.

Today using robots in dangerous police operations and for neutralizing criminals is a common practice. Governments of certain countries consider replacing human nurses in maternity homes with medical robots.

Employees of Innopolis University have surveyed 300 participants of the  Russian Robot Olympiad who came to Innopolis from 51 regions of the Russian Federation. The purpose of the survey is to learn what children think about robots and how they see the future of human-robot interaction.
